    On October 3, 2013, Councilmember Kenyan R. McDuffie, Chairperson of the Committee on Government Operations, will convene a public hearing on B20-0169 The “Employee Suggestion Act of 2013” and B20-0251 the “Government Managers Accountability Amendment Act of 2013”. This public hearing will be held in Room 123 of the John A. Wilson Building, 1350 Pennsylvania Ave, NW at 11:00 AM.

     

    The purpose of this hearing is to give the public the opportunity to comment on these measures. The following is an outline of the stated purpose of each bill scheduled to be considered at this hearing:

     

     

    ·         The stated purpose of the “Employee Suggestion Act of 2013” is to establish an Employee Suggestion Evaluation Commission to review District employee suggestions and grant cash awards to District employees who propose solutions that contribute to government economy or efficiency, and to create the Employee Suggestion Merit Award Fund.

     

     

    ·         The stated purpose of the “Government Managers Accountability Amendment Act of 2013” is to amend the District of Columbia Government Comprehensive Merit Personnel Act of 1978 to revise the definition for management employee to clarify that any individual whose functions include the responsibility for program or project management with or without supervision of staff are considered management employees.
